INTRODUCTION The purpose of this memorandum is to recommend the annual renewal of the above liquor license establishments and to highlight the calls for service related to incidences of disturbances, crimes against persons, crimes against property, and public morals occurring at the business since the last liquor license renewal. BACKGROUND Regarding the listed establishments, the following is a summary of activity since their last renewal. The following key provides a brief description of those calls for service displaying four areas of concern. Disturbances Includes physical fighting, verbal arguments, loud music and /or subjects and all other disorderly behavior not already listed Crimes Against Persons Includes Assault and Harassment Crimes Against Property Includes Burglary, Criminal Mischief and Theft Public Morals Includes Public Intoxication and Possession of Controlled Substances 1 DISCUSSION CHOPPER'S, 601 RHOMBERG AVE. Since the last renewal date there have been four calls for service to the establishment. There were no disturbances, no crimes against persons, no crimes against property and one public morals call. Additionally, there were no individual violations and two violations against the business. Since the last renewal date there have been 19 calls for service to the establishment. There were no disturbances, one crime against persons, nine crimes against property and no public morals calls. Additionally, there were four individual violations and no violations against the business. Since the last renewal date there have been 137 calls for service to the establishment. There were 20 disturbances, eight crimes against persons, four crimes against property and five public morals calls. Additionally, there were 53 individual violations and no violations against the business.
